200 Xugong Heavy-duty Dumpers Exported to Central Asia
www.chinatrucks.com: Recently 200 Xugong heavy-duty dumpers were exported to Central Asia.

Xugong trucks
Xugong established perfect sales networks in Central Asia by their efforts and help of local dealers. Xugong also support distributors of all levels on technology. They have set hotlines to make sure that customers' problems can be solved in time. At the same time, local dealers advertise XCMG trucks in key exhibitions, newspapers, TV and the Internet. Xugong also sent talented employees to serve customers directly.
